Tesco wishes people a Merry Christmas in its 2017 Christmas advert, highlighting that “Every family has a different turkey tale” and that, however you cook yours, Tesco has got a turkey for you, as well.
The 60-second spot, titled “Turkey, Every Which Way”, which marks the start of the British retailer’s “Everyone’s Welcome” campaign, features several families of various backgrounds and religions getting together for preparing and eating the festive turkey, that is (obviously) purchased from Tesco. Despite the different ways they choose to cook their turkey and the issues some of them are facing while handling it, they are all happy to celebrate together this special holiday, sit around the table and have fun, and indulge themselves later on with a turkey sandwich.
The advert, created by BBH London and set to the rhythms of a cover of Shakin’ Stevens’ iconic 1991 festive song “Merry Christmas Everyone”, also highlights that you can find turkeys in selected Superstores & Extras from December 19 and pre-order them online from November 26.
Tesco has also launched an donation scheme aiming to support 6,700 charities across the country in their mission to help people experiencing food poverty or who are alone at this time of year. Thus, between November 6 and December 25, the retailer will donate £1 for every fresh turkey sold to food charity partners FareShare and The Trussell Trust.
